The quiet room on the top floor of Ashenby Court is available to all staff between 08:00 and 19:00. Reception should direct anyone asking to the east stairwell, not the lifts, as the lift does not serve that landing. No bookings are needed, but only two occupants are allowed at a time. The stairwell door stays locked and opens with the code below.

staff pass of kawep-hahap = bdg-IEUUF-6

Before archiving a cold storage bucket in Glacierette, detach all plugin hooks. Run the freeze job, confirm checksum parity, then revoke scoped tokens. Do not delete manifests; the Vexhall recovery service reads them during account restoration. If the bucket owner's account is locked, trigger the recovery flow from the Opsgate console, not the plugin API. Archival completes within 20 minutes. Plugins must tolerate 404s on frozen objects. To unseal the restore job, use the passphrase below.

vault phrase of fawig-yagug = tamix-norys-ulaix-joreth-druius-jorael-briax-prair-lamael-caseth-brivan-lamius-istius

## Account Recovery — PortionPal

Scope: locked admin accounts on the PortionPal recipe-scaling calculator.

Steps: verify requester in the Brindleworth staff roster, disable MFA token, trigger reset from the ops console. If the console itself is locked out, boot the fallback admin shell on node two. The shell prompts for the recovery passphrase shown below.

strongbox words: druox-olimir

MEMO — Tillbrook & Sons, Branch Managers

Folks, the commission scheme got a refresh. Short version: flat 6% is gone. New tiers reward multi-year contracts and the Harrowgate product line, which we need moving. Quota relief for branches hit by the Pellman recall is baked in. Full tables land in your inboxes Friday. One more thing before the spreadsheets arrive — the strategic context is below.

internal memo for kawip-hadug: Headcount on the Wenwyn team goes from 7 to 140 by the end of January. Gross margin on Wenwyn came in at 20 percent against a plan of 15 percent.